Key elements affecting project costs

Barn siding installation in Litchfield County, CT, involves selecting appropriate materials and assessing the scope of work to match the style and function of the structure.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this type of upgrade or construction.

  • Materials: Common options include wood, vinyl, or fiber cement siding, each offering different durability and appearance suited to barn structures.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small sections to full barn exteriors, influencing overall complexity and material requirements.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ation may involve framing adjustments, precise fitting, and weatherproofing, depending on the existing structure and chosen materials.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Litchfield County may require permits for structural modifications or exterior renovations, particularly for larger projects.
  • Additional Options: Extras such as insulation, decorative trim, or weather barriers can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.
